Course Overview

This highly practical course is suitable for those interested in acquiring the foundational knowledge, skills and understanding to work in the land-based sector.

You will learn how to work safely, care for animals, and maintain structures, as well as gain first-hand experience of working on-and-around farms.

Topics may include:

  • Safe and effective working practices in land-based industries
  • Use of transport and assisting with the maintenance of tools and equipment
  • Assisting with the care of animals
  • Assisting with the movement, handling, and accommodation of animals
  • An introduction to crop systems
  • Tractor operations
  • An introduction to wildlife and conservation
  • Developing performance.

Assessment Methods

This course involves classroom-based and practical work, with hands-on experience in a variety of land-based industries. Previous students have taken part in trips and visits related to the course.

Assessment is based on a portfolio of evidence that includes written assignments, practical assessments (including work experience), and an externally marked online assessment.

Progression Options

On successful completion of this course, you will be equipped with the knowledge and skills to move into employment at a practical level, or you could progress onto a Level 2 course (subject to successful interview).

Entry Requirements

You need GCSEs in the 3 to 1 range, or other equivalent qualifications. A genuine interest in land-based industries and a willingness to learn are vital. You will be invited to attend an interview to assess your suitability for the course.
